Why were the ruins of Volubilis looted over time?

  • For building Meknes

  • To find treasure

  • As a form of protest

  • Due to local superstitions

Answer

The ruins of Volubilis were looted over time because they were used as a source of building materials for the construction of Meknes. The city of Meknes was founded in the 17th century by Moulay Ismail, the third sultan of the Alaouite dynasty. He chose Meknes as his capital because of its strategic location and its proximity to the Atlas Mountains.
